For those who use Godaddy as a registrar, have you found the "whois count" data to be accurate and/or useful?
It seemed interesting at first, but it's showing 0 on domains that I personally did a whois lookup on AT the Godaddy website. If they can't track their own whois queries, how can they track them from other systems?
Other domains of low value or very specific niche sometimes have 45 more more lookups in the month. I'm not sure I trust this, or can make any value decisions based on it.
